The hexadecimal color code #364547 corresponds to the code RGB( 54, 69, 71 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,21 level), green (at 0,27 level) and blue (at 0,28 level). Its brightness is 24% and its saturation is 13%. It is composed of red at 27%, green at 35% and blue at 36%.
